Produktbeschreibung
Today's world is marked with number of challenges to meet. With every passing moment it is getting difficult for a common man to survive and combat with these competitive challenges. It is observed that individuals get failed to maintain balance between their work and family life because they devote much of their time to their work, ignoring their family relationships. This not only affects their family life but also their mental health in many ways. Work is an important element in one's life.It is also observed that individuals get failed to maintain balance between their work and family life because they devote much of their time to their work, ignoring their family relationships. This not only affects their family life but also our mental health in many ways. Workaholism is an individual's stability and extensive distribution of time to job-related actions and belief which does not compel from peripheral variables. Workaholism is employee's unnecessary deep immersion into his/her work to the extent that it affects his/her health. Present day work environment and competition foster such traits that propel an employee to opt for such work style.
